Real life JR keeps reminder of drinking demons
Larry Hagman has a constant reminder of his boozy past - the picture of the man whose liver kept the former Dallas star alive.
Hagman, who played oil tycoon JR Ewing in the hit 1970s and 1980s soap, needed a liver transplant after years of heavy drinking almost cost him his life.
He explains: "I drank my liver out - over 40 years of drinking - and I feel great now. I have somebody else's liver and I give thanks to him everyday. I have his picture next to my shaving mirror."
